Manchester United expect Nick Powell to leave the club in the summer after his loan move to Hull, Football Insider sources understand.
The 21-year-old playmaker completed a deadline day move to the Championship high flyers on loan until the end of the season.
However, Powell's United contract expires in the summer and a United source has told Football Insider there has been no indication he will be handed an extension.

Powell, 21, has had scarce first-team involvement at Old Trafford after making little progress during his three-and-a-half years at the club.
He has made only nine first-team appearances and just two this season, which bizarrely came when he was thrust on as a substitute for Juan Mata when Louis van Gaal's team were chasing late goals against Wolfsburg and Bournemouth in December.
